Tried their $30 diagnostic service. Tech just speculated about all the things that could be wrong and hardly did any troubleshooting. Said they would get back to me and never did either. Tried to upsell replacing all the equipment. Winded up just using youtube/google and diagnosed / fixed problem myself.

EDIT: Hi Pete- The problem I had was an error code on the control valve which indicated pressure sensor issue. My expectation was that the tech will come with equipment to identify/narrow down the component(s) that may be causing the issue and provide options, eg having a simple manometer to check if the negative air pressure generated from the blower matches the specs required by the pressure sensor. (which was the root cause). instead, tech just wiggled a few connections, and kept saying my tank is old and its not worth replacing just one part and I should buy a whole new water tank. I insisted on exploring replacing parts, and they took some part numbers and said they will get back to me and never did. Cost of the new blower was $350 vs a new hot water heater which would have been well over 1k.
